About Maxime Fleury

Maxime Fleury is a scholar working on Epidemiology, Infectious Diseases, Pulmonary and Respiratory Medicine, Molecular Biology and Genetics, having authored 30 papers that have together received 928 indexed citations. Recurring topics across this work include Antifungal resistance and susceptibility (9 papers), Cervical Cancer and HPV Research (8 papers), Fungal Infections and Studies (7 papers), Cystic Fibrosis Research Advances (6 papers), Virus-based gene therapy research (5 papers), Hepatitis B Virus Studies (4 papers), Polyomavirus and related diseases (4 papers) and Antenna Design and Analysis (3 papers). The work is most often cited by research in Dermatology (100 citations), Immunology and Allergy (66 citations), Oncology (255 citations), Infectious Diseases (168 citations) and Epidemiology (235 citations). Maxime Fleury has collaborated with scholars based in France, Italy and Canada. Frequent co-authors include Jean‐Philippe Bouchara, Pierre Coursaget, Antoine Touzé, Cindy Staerck, Alphonse Calenda, Patrick Vandeputte, Nicolas Papon, Amandine Gastebois, Gérald Larcher and Mauro Tognon. Their work appears in journals such as Journal of Virology, Medical Mycology, Clinical and Vaccine Immunology, Journal of Fungi and Journal of Clinical Microbiology.
